The South Asian native plant Moringa oleifera has drawn a lot of interest lately because of its many health advantages. This thorough analysis seeks to condense the therapeutic potential of Moringa oleifera leaves, with an emphasis on their pharmacological characteristics and benefits to health [1-3]. The photochemical makeup, anti-inflammatory, antibacterial, anticancer, and hepatoprotective properties of Moringa oleifera leaves are only a few of the many subjects covered in this paper. The possible mechanisms of action that might be responsible for these effects are also covered. The review further investigates the safety profile and possible negative consequences of consuming leaves of Moringa oleifera [4-5]. All things considered, this review offers insightful information about the therapeutic qualities of Moringa oleifera leaves and emphasizes their possible uses in the di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of a range of illnesses.
